COLORADO: EIGHT DENVER SEX OFFENDERS BACK IN CUSTODY (Court Stays Earlier Ruling, Authories Re-Jailing)
Confusion began when the state Supreme Court ruled on September 18th that a 1993 law adding five year paroles to felony convictions could not be applied to sex crimes. Eight of nine sex offenders who were turned loose in the weeks between the ruling on parole guidelines and the court’s agreement to reconsider were taken back into custody on Sunday.
